LIMS improves water testing laboratory efficiency

A new case study has been published by Autoscribe Informatics which shows how the Culligan Analytical Lab in Illinois, USA has made significant improvements in laboratory efficiency by using the Matrix Gemini LIMS (Laboratory Information Management System). Culligan Water provides innovative water treatment solutions to domestic, commercial and industrial markets. Laboratory testing to provide an accurate analysis of a customer’s water quality is a key component of the company’s success, especially as many customers are using well water.
Handling around 17,000 samples per year, with each sample undergoing multiple tests and turnaround times as short as 24 hours often required, the need to drive and maintain laboratory efficiency is very important. Replacing the previous LIMS used by the laboratory, Matrix Gemini removed a major bottleneck by using barcoding to replace the manual scanning and saving as PDFs of sample request forms. In addition, the system was configured to automate the collection of test results and eliminate transcription errors by transferring data directly into Matrix Gemini from ICP, IC, UV/Vis, and titration equipment.
The laboratory is certified to be compliant with the National Environmental Laboratory Accreditation Program (NELAP), which is modelled after similar ISO standards. The audit trail provided within Matrix Gemini is completely in line with the requirements of NELAP.
Using the built-in configuration tools, screens were configured to automatically populate information from the log-in screen to make the flow more intuitive and efficient.With sample requests coming from many different Culligan dealers, Matrix Gemini was able to access all the required dealer information automatically.. The system also maintains continuity between results generated by 3rd parties and results generated internally; Matrix Gemini ensures that the full set of results are always reported.
